IPX/SPX协议概要

news/2025/3/20 11:55:20/
论上来说,TCP/IP就可以保证互通,但是一些朋友在对连时常常碰到需要安装IPX/SPX NETBIOS协议,感到很郁闷
IPX/SPX协议即IPX(全称Internetwork Packet Exchange网间数据包交换)与SPX(全称Sequences Packet Exchange 顺序包交换)协议的组合,它是Novell公司为了适应网络的发展而开发的通信协议,具有很强的适应性,安装方便,同时还具有路由功能,可以实现多网段间的通信。其中,IPX协议负责数据包的传送;SPX负责数据包传输的完整性。在微软的NT操作系统中,一般使用NWLink IPX/SPX兼容协议和NWLink NetBIOX两种IPX/SPX的兼容协议,即NWLink协议,该兼容协议继承了IPX/SPX协议优点,更适应Windows的网络环境 ——
虽然这些游戏通过TCP/IP协议也能联机,但显然还是通过IPX/SPX协议更省事,因为根本不需要任何设置。除此之外,IPX/SPX协议在局域网络中的用途似乎并不是很大,如果确定不在局域网中联机玩游戏,那么这个协议可有可无。PX/SPX协议本来就是Novell开发的专用于NetWare网络中的协议,但是现在也非常常用--大部分可以联机的游戏都支持IPX/SPX协议,比如星际争霸,反恐精英等等

一个说明问题的实验

局域网内两机,使用DHCP服务器获得IP地址,查看A机IP:192.168.10.56,子网掩码255.255.255.0,默认网关192.168.10.1
B机为IP:192.168.10.65,子网掩码255.255.255.0,默认网关:192.168.10.1,首选DNS都是为192.168.10.1,此时所有的内网主机都能互相访问
那么更改下配置,在本地连接中A机IP:172.16.0.1,子网掩码255.255.255.0,默认网关172.16.0.1
B机IP:172.16.0.2,子网掩码:255.255.255.0,默认网关172.16.0.1,DNS都为172.16.0.1,这时A和B都能互相访问
但是A在网上邻居中能看到并且访问除B以外别的机子
是不是觉得很奇怪,设置的是A和B在同一子网172.16.0.0能通信,而别的机器是在子网192.168.10.0中,按理是不能通信的


其实很简单,先看看控制面板》管理工具》路由和远程访问,是否开了路由,但是我的设置没开,再看看协议里除了TCP/IP,还有NWLink IPX/SPX,这就很明显了~~~~


TCP/IP协议不能实现不同子网通信时,NWLink IPX/SPX就生效了
为了验证正确性,A和B机删除此协议后,除A和B能通信外,不能访问不在同一子网中的机子了~~~


自己动手做个实验,我想就能真正领会下IPX/SPX NETBIOS的作用了!

 

http://www.ppmy.cn/news/310514.html

相关文章

XCP协议简介

XCP协议简介 文章目录 XCP协议简介一、概要分类:优点:功能:通信方式: 二、主从模式三、网络和传输模式四、CTO & DTO五、报文格式和PID六、访问测量/校准对象七、测量1、异步测量1、SHORT_UPLOAD命令:2、SHORT_UPL…

python 下使用 cplex

文章目录 1. cplex python API 的安装2. 简单的使用例子3. 使用感受 最近熟悉 python,也想掌握 python 下面的 cplex 的调用,查阅了相关资料,总结如下: 1. cplex python API 的安装 网上说的比较复杂,若直接寻找 cple…

springboot项目代码混淆和反编译教程·附软件连接

对springboot项目进行代码混淆,可以防止别人通过反编译项目查看代码,即使反编译了查看的也是混淆后的看不懂的代码。 一定程度保证了项目源码安全性。 下面分享代码混淆步骤和反编译操作 Allatori-7.7 代码混淆操作步骤 使用方法 1、首先从官网下载&a…

IPX

IPX IPX:互联网分组交换协议 (IPX:Internetwork Packet Exchange protocol)是一个专用的协议簇,它主要由Novell NetWare操作系统使用。IPX是IPX协议簇中的第三层协议。 1.IPX的协议构成 IPX协议簇包括如下主要协议: ●IPX:第三层协…

饥荒联机版steam专用服务器创建

饥荒联机版steam专用服务器创建 喜欢饥荒的小伙伴儿都知道饥荒这款游戏一起玩儿会比较快乐,但是使用电脑创建的服务器,经常会因为玩的天数长了,电脑服务器偶尔会崩溃,但好在官方提供了专用服务器,本文参考较多教程&am…

什么时候适合加一层?

加一层能解决问题: 为什么加一层能解决问题? 什么时候适合加一层? 销售说不吵的, 道路检测说没有超标。 业主就是睡不着。 吃瓜群众说你为啥买那边的房子。 销售说开发商骗他,他也是受害者。 结果没问题&#xff0…

计算机网络 — 网络层

一、网络层简介 网络层介于传输层和数据链路层之间,其主要作用是实现两个不同网络系统之间的数据透明传送,具体包括路由选择,拥塞控制和网际互连等。网络层负责在不同的网络之间(基于数据包的IP地址)尽力转发数据包,不负责丢包重传…

如何利用samba(smb服务)实现网络文件共享

文章目录 samba实现网络文件共享前言实验环境利用samba搭建共享文件系统详细步骤匿名用户读写共享文件指定用户读写共享文件的权限 利用smb服务访问win10的共享目录 samba实现网络文件共享 前言 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客…